Borgarfjordur eystri (BGJ) to Edinburgh (EDI)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Borgarfjordur eystri Airport (BGJ) in Borgarfjordur eystri, Iceland to Edinburgh Airport (EDI) in Edinburgh, United Kingdom is 1,202 kilometers (747 miles / 649 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 2h, flying south southeast at a heading of 147°.

This is a short-haul route typically served by narrow-body aircraft such as the Boeing 737 or Airbus A320 family. In-flight service is usually limited to drinks and light snacks.

This is an international route connecting Iceland with United Kingdom.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.
